Publisher's Synopsis

The Jack Russell Terrier was originally bred as a working Terrier, and this book is essential reading for those who wish to understand the true character of their animal. Brian Plummer begins by dispelling the myths that surround the type's origins, then moves on to give comprehensive advice on the choice of a terrier, its rearing, and entering as a working dog. Aspects of breeding are then covered, together with show entering and the treatment of common ailments. Side-by-side with practical advice he includes a wealth of readable and entertaining anecdotes.
